03 October 2007
* (nicm) Rewrite command handling so commands are much more generic and the
same commands are used for command line and keys (although most will probably
need to check how they are called). Currently incomplete (only new/detach/ls
implemented).
* (nicm) String number arguments. So you can do: tmux bind ^Q create "blah".
* (nicm) Key binding. tmux bind key command [argument] and tmux unbind key.
Key names are in a table in key-string.c, plus A is A, ^A is ctrl-A.

cmd-detach-session.c Normal file
View File

@ -0,0 +1,137 @@
/* $Id: cmd-detach-session.c,v 1.1 2007-10-03 21:31:07 nicm Exp $ */
/*
* Copyright (c) 2007 Nicholas Marriott <nicm@users.sourceforge.net>
*
* Permission to use, copy, modify, and distribute this software for any
* purpose with or without fee is hereby granted, provided that the above
* copyright notice and this permission notice appear in all copies.
*
* THE SOFTWARE IS PROVIDED "AS IS" AND THE AUTHOR DISCLAIMS ALL WARRANTIES
* WITH REGARD TO THIS SOFTWARE INCLUDING ALL IMPLIED WARRANTIES OF
* MERCHANTABILITY AND FITNESS. IN NO EVENT SHALL THE AUTHOR BE LIABLE FOR
* ANY SPECIAL, DIRECT, INDIRECT, OR CONSEQUENTIAL DAMAGES OR ANY DAMAGES
* WHATSOEVER RESULTING FROM LOSS OF MIND, USE, DATA OR PROFITS, WHETHER
* IN AN ACTION OF CONTRACT, NEGLIGENCE OR OTHER TORTIOUS ACTION, ARISING
* OUT OF OR IN CONNECTION WITH THE USE OR PERFORMANCE OF THIS SOFTWARE.
*/
#include <sys/types.h>
#include <getopt.h>
#include "tmux.h"
/*
* Detach session. If called with -a detach all clients attached to specified
* session, otherwise detach current session on key press only.
*/
int cmd_detach_session_parse(void **, int, char **, char **);
const char *cmd_detach_session_usage(void);
void cmd_detach_session_exec(void *, struct cmd_ctx *);
void cmd_detach_session_send(void *, struct buffer *);
void cmd_detach_session_recv(void **, struct buffer *);
void cmd_detach_session_free(void *);
struct cmd_detach_session_data {
int flag_all;
};
const struct cmd_entry cmd_detach_session_entry = {
CMD_DETACHSESSION, "detach-session", "detach", 0,
cmd_detach_session_parse,
cmd_detach_session_usage,
cmd_detach_session_exec,
cmd_detach_session_send,
cmd_detach_session_recv,
cmd_detach_session_free
};
int
cmd_detach_session_parse(void **ptr, int argc, char **argv, char **cause)
{
struct cmd_detach_session_data *data;
int opt;
*ptr = data = xmalloc(sizeof *data);
data->flag_all = 0;
while ((opt = getopt(argc, argv, "a")) != EOF) {
switch (opt) {
case 'a':
data->flag_all = 1;
break;
default:
goto usage;
}
}
argc -= optind;
argv -= optind;
if (argc != 0)
goto usage;
return (0);
usage:
usage(cause, "%s", cmd_detach_session_usage());
xfree(data);
return (-1);
}
const char *
cmd_detach_session_usage(void)
{
return ("detach-session [-a]");
}
void
cmd_detach_session_exec(void *ptr, struct cmd_ctx *ctx)
{
struct cmd_detach_session_data *data = ptr, std = { 0 };
struct client *c = ctx->client, *cp;
struct session *s = ctx->session;
u_int i;
if (data == NULL)
data = &std;
if (data->flag_all) {
for (i = 0; i < ARRAY_LENGTH(&clients); i++) {
cp = ARRAY_ITEM(&clients, i);
if (cp == NULL || cp->session != s)
continue;
server_write_client(cp, MSG_DETACH, NULL, 0);
}
} else if (ctx->flags & CMD_KEY)
server_write_client(c, MSG_DETACH, NULL, 0);
if (!(ctx->flags & CMD_KEY))
server_write_client(c, MSG_EXIT, NULL, 0);
}
void
cmd_detach_session_send(void *ptr, struct buffer *b)
{
struct cmd_detach_session_data *data = ptr;
buffer_write(b, data, sizeof *data);
}
void
cmd_detach_session_recv(void **ptr, struct buffer *b)
{
struct cmd_detach_session_data *data;
*ptr = data = xmalloc(sizeof *data);
buffer_read(b, data, sizeof *data);
}
void
cmd_detach_session_free(void *ptr)
{
struct cmd_detach_session_data *data = ptr;
xfree(data);
}

cmd-new-session.c Normal file
View File

@ -0,0 +1,162 @@
/* $Id: cmd-new-session.c,v 1.1 2007-10-03 21:31:07 nicm Exp $ */
/*
* Copyright (c) 2007 Nicholas Marriott <nicm@users.sourceforge.net>
*
* Permission to use, copy, modify, and distribute this software for any
* purpose with or without fee is hereby granted, provided that the above
* copyright notice and this permission notice appear in all copies.
*
* THE SOFTWARE IS PROVIDED "AS IS" AND THE AUTHOR DISCLAIMS ALL WARRANTIES
* WITH REGARD TO THIS SOFTWARE INCLUDING ALL IMPLIED WARRANTIES OF
* MERCHANTABILITY AND FITNESS. IN NO EVENT SHALL THE AUTHOR BE LIABLE FOR
* ANY SPECIAL, DIRECT, INDIRECT, OR CONSEQUENTIAL DAMAGES OR ANY DAMAGES
* WHATSOEVER RESULTING FROM LOSS OF MIND, USE, DATA OR PROFITS, WHETHER
* IN AN ACTION OF CONTRACT, NEGLIGENCE OR OTHER TORTIOUS ACTION, ARISING
* OUT OF OR IN CONNECTION WITH THE USE OR PERFORMANCE OF THIS SOFTWARE.
*/
#include <sys/types.h>
#include <getopt.h>
#include "tmux.h"
/*
* Create a new session and attach to the current terminal unless -d is given.
*/
int cmd_new_session_parse(void **, int, char **, char **);
const char *cmd_new_session_usage(void);
void cmd_new_session_exec(void *, struct cmd_ctx *);
void cmd_new_session_send(void *, struct buffer *);
void cmd_new_session_recv(void **, struct buffer *);
void cmd_new_session_free(void *);
struct cmd_new_session_data {
char *name;
int flag_detached;
};
const struct cmd_entry cmd_new_session_entry = {
CMD_NEWSESSION, "new-session", "new", CMD_STARTSERVER|CMD_NOSESSION,
cmd_new_session_parse,
cmd_new_session_usage,
cmd_new_session_exec,
cmd_new_session_send,
cmd_new_session_recv,
cmd_new_session_free
};
int
cmd_new_session_parse(void **ptr, int argc, char **argv, char **cause)
{
struct cmd_new_session_data *data;
int opt;
*ptr = data = xmalloc(sizeof *data);
data->flag_detached = 0;
data->name = NULL;
while ((opt = getopt(argc, argv, "ds:")) != EOF) {
switch (opt) {
case 'd':
data->flag_detached = 1;
break;
case 's':
data->name = xstrdup(optarg);
break;
default:
goto usage;
}
}
argc -= optind;
argv -= optind;
if (argc != 0)
goto usage;
return (0);
usage:
usage(cause, "%s", cmd_new_session_usage());
if (data->name != NULL)
xfree(data->name);
xfree(data);
return (-1);
}
const char *
cmd_new_session_usage(void)
{
return ("new-session [-d] [-n session name]");
}
void
cmd_new_session_exec(void *ptr, struct cmd_ctx *ctx)
{
struct cmd_new_session_data *data = ptr, std = { NULL, 0 };
struct client *c = ctx->client;
u_int sy;
if (data == NULL)
data = &std;
if (ctx->flags & CMD_KEY)
return;
if (!data->flag_detached && !(c->flags & CLIENT_TERMINAL)) {
ctx->error(ctx, "not a terminal");
return;
}
if (data->name != NULL && session_find(data->name) != NULL) {
ctx->error(ctx, "duplicate session: %s", data->name);
return;
}
sy = c->sy;
if (sy < status_lines)
sy = status_lines + 1;
sy -= status_lines;
c->session = session_create(data->name, default_command, c->sx, sy);
if (c->session == NULL)
fatalx("session_create failed");
if (data->flag_detached)
server_write_client(c, MSG_EXIT, NULL, 0);
else {
server_write_client(c, MSG_READY, NULL, 0);
server_draw_client(c);
}
}
void
cmd_new_session_send(void *ptr, struct buffer *b)
{
struct cmd_new_session_data *data = ptr;
buffer_write(b, data, sizeof *data);
cmd_send_string(b, data->name);
}
void
cmd_new_session_recv(void **ptr, struct buffer *b)
{
struct cmd_new_session_data *data;
*ptr = data = xmalloc(sizeof *data);
buffer_read(b, data, sizeof *data);
data->name = cmd_recv_string(b);
}
void
cmd_new_session_free(void *ptr)
{
struct cmd_new_session_data *data = ptr;
if (data->name != NULL)
xfree(data->name);
xfree(data);
}
